[Convenience store chain McColl's is on the brink of collapse, potentially placing thousands of jobs at risk. The retailer said it was "increasingly likely" it would fall into administration unless talks around a rescue deal were successful. The statement on Thursday came after Sky News reported the company could call administrators in on Friday. More than 16,000 people are employed by McColl's, which also has a partnership with supermarket Morrisons. The company wrote that without any fresh funding in the short-term, the group would likely "be placed into administration with the objective of achieving a sale of the group to a third-party purchaser and securing the interests of creditors and employees".] https://www.bbc.co.uk/news/business-61341350 |

Supermarket giant Morrisons has proposed a last-minute rescue deal for McColl's, the convenience store chain which is on the brink of collapse.
McColl's warned last night that unless it secured more funding, administration was increasingly likely. A deal with Morrisons would potentially secure 16,000 jobs at the embattled retail chain. Morrisons is in a partnership with McColl's with more than 200 Morrisons Daily convenience stores. The BBC understands that the aim of the deal would be to save as many stores and jobs as possible. The improved offer, made on Thursday evening, is thought to include taking on McColl's pension commitments and its £170m debt. Morrisons has been talking to McColl's and creditors for weeks as it aims to thrash out a rescue deal. McColl's is running out of cash, and needs an injection of funds to stay afloat https://www.bbc.co.uk/news/business-61346747 |

McColl's: Billionaire Issa brothers close to rescue deal,
[The billionaire Issa brothers are poised to rescue the convenience chain McColl's as it enters administration. PwC is set to become the administrators for the company and it is understood a sale to the Issa brothers' EG Group could come soon after. In a letter from McColl's to its employees, seen by the BBC, the firm said it hoped all staff would transfer to the new owner. If successful, the deal could safeguard 16,000 jobs and 1,100 McColl's stores. The Issa brothers also co-own supermarket chain Asda, while EG Group owns thousands of petrol stations and convenience shops in the UK, Ireland, Europe, Australia and the US.] https://www.bbc.co.uk/news/uk-61351412 |
